Why do radio stations use W and K?

The letters ‘N’ and ‘A’ were given to military stations, but ‘K’ and ‘W’ were assigned out for commercial use. Radio stations east of the Mississippi River had to start their stations with ‘W’, and stations west of the Mississippi with ‘K’.

Where do the call letters change from W to K?

Geographical separation of K and W call signs The blue section in the west has normally received K calls, while the eastern red section has normally received W. The yellow section in the middle received W calls from 1912 until January 1923, when a boundary shift to the Mississippi River transferred it to K territory.
